How do I see disk partitions in Windows?

Locate the disk you want to check in the Disk Management window. Right-click it and select “Properties.” Click over to the “Volumes” tab. To the right of “Partition style,” you’ll see either “Master Boot Record (MBR)” or “GUID Partition Table (GPT),” depending on which the disk is using.

Which Windows tool can you use to partition a disk drive?

Windows 10 Disk Management is a built-in tool which can be used to create, delete, format, extend and shrink partitions, and initialize a new hard drive as MBR or GPT.

How do I check hard drive usage?

Click on System. Click on Storage. Under the “Local storage” section, click the drive to see the storage usage. While on “Storage usage,” you can see what’s taking up space on the hard drive.

How do I find out what program is using my hard drive?

Just type resmon into the Start menu search, or open Task Manager and click the “Resource Monitor” button on the Performance tab. Once in Resource Monitor, go to the Disk tab. There you can see which processes are accessing your disks, and exactly which disks and which files they’re accessing.

Where do I find system and utility partitions?

To verify that system and utility partitions exist Click Start, right-click This PC, and then click Manage. Click Disk Management. In the list of drives and partitions, confirm that the system and utility partitions are present and are not assigned a drive letter.
